Hello,
For starters I wanted to know if it's advisable to add the steam.exe and steamwebhelper.exe to the list of protected applications in MBAM Premium real-time protection list. I did just that and added steam as a "media player" (??) and steamwebhelper.exe as a Chromium based browser. Last night I purchased Nier: Automata and upon executing it for the first time (triggering its install process) MBAM blocked the nierautomata.exe saying it was a generic exploit agent. Subsequent attempts after verifying the game's integrity reproduces the same behavior.
Most importantly I would like to know if adding STEAM and STEAMWEBHELPER to the protected applications list, as I have, is recommended -- or should I change the program type from MEDIA PLAYER to OTHER? If not a config issue then perhaps I'm just reporting a false positive. (I hope)
How should I proceed?

Thanks shadowwar, 

In general, is there a best practice for configuring MBAM to work with Steam? I would imagine a significant percentage of MBAM customers use that software but I'm having trouble finding data on it (particularly for MBAM 3+). Steam does use a Chromium build as it's web browser overlay while running games or watching media - and it's a full fledged browser without extension support -- so vulnerable to Javascript Exploits, etc. It's tricky tho because it also has Anti-Cheating mechanisms that may or may not work with MBAM's hooks. It also constantly installs Visual Studio Redistribs and DirectX so that might be False-Positive hell. 

Any ideas? Or could you point me in a good direction where this has been discussed?
